We all need our rest. That includes rest for our minds as well as for our bodies. Let’s not forget that to be the safest requires our best in actions and reactions to changes along the journey.

Keeping sharp, able to react, thinking, predicting, and engaged requires us to rest every now and again. Take a few extra hours today or during our next opportunity to relax. Sleep would be great, but to just relax – away the phone preferably.

How awesome would it be if we knew everyone around us was rested, awake, focused, and working to be the most safe possible just like us?
